CHAYOTE SQUASH SALAD (SALADA DE CHUCHU)



Chayote Squash Salad (Salada de Chuchu) image

Simple Easy to make salad with a South American vegetable that is becoming increasingly more available in US markets.

Time 40m

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 quart water
6 chayotes, peeled,cores removed
3 cloves garlic, crushed
1 large onion, thinly sliced
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on ground black pepper
6 tablespoons Italian parsley, chopped
1/4 cup olive oil
5 tablespoons white vinegar

Steps:

  • Bring the water to a boil in a deep pot.
  • Put the chayote squash into the boiling water and boil for 10 minutes; do not overcook.
  • Drain in a colander.
  • Slice the squash and place in a salad bowl with garlic, onion, salt, pepper, parsley, oil and vinegar.
  • Mix well and refrigerate before serving.

CUBAN CHAYOTE SALAD

Time 25m

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 5

6 chayotes (also known as meletons or mirletons)
1/2 teaspoon mustard
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on black pepper
1/4 cup extra virgin olive oil

Steps:

  • Boil chayotes until tender, 10-15 minutes. Remove from heat and cut into 1" cubes.
  • Mix the rest of ingredients and pour over cubed chayote.
  • Place in refrigerator for about 1 hour.
  • Serve over lettuce. Enjoy!

CHAYOTE SALAD

Time 15m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

3 chayotes, pitted and thinly sliced
1 serrano chili pepper, seeded and finely chopped (wear plastic gloves when handling)
1/4 cup fresh cilantro, chopped
1 small lemon, juiced and strained
1/3 cup extra virgin olive oil
2 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
salt
fresh ground black pepper
fresh cilantro stem (to garnish)

Steps:

  • Combine chayote, chile pepper, cilantro, lemon juice, oil, and vinegar in large bowl.
  • Toss to thoroughly coat.
  • Sprinkle with salt and pepper.
  • Garnish with cilantro springs.
